造成Linux启动卡在initramfs阶段的原因有很多,主要包括硬件故障、文件系统损坏、内核配置错误等。首先,硬件故障可能会导致系统无法正常加载必要的驱动程序或模块,从而造成系统无法启动。其次,文件系统损坏也可能会导致系统启动失败,initramfs无法正确加载所需的文件。此外,内核配置错误也是一个常见的问题,如果内核配置不正确,可能会导致系统无法正常启动。
针对Linux启动卡在initramfs的问题,可以采取一些方法来解决。首先,可以尝试重启系统,有时候系统只是临时出现问题,重启后可能会恢复正常。如果重启无效,可以尝试进入initramfs环境,查看错误信息并尝试修复问题。在initramfs环境中,可以尝试挂载文件系统、修复文件系统错误、重新加载驱动程序等操作,以恢复系统正常启动。
另外,也可以尝试使用Live CD或USB启动系统,通过外部系统访问硬盘上的文件系统,进行故障诊断和修复。在外部系统中,可以查看日志文件、检查硬件状态、修复文件系统等操作,以解决导致系统无法启动的问题。
总的来说,Linux启动卡在initramfs阶段是一个比较常见的问题,可能由多种原因导致。对于这种情况,用户可以尝试一些基本的故障诊断和修复操作,如重启系统、进入initramfs环境、使用Live CD等,以尽快解决问题,恢复系统正常启动。同时,在平时的使用过程中,用户也应该注意系统的健康状态,定期备份重要数据,以减少系统故障对用户造成的损失。通过及时发现和解决问题,可以保证系统的稳定性和可靠性,提高用户体验。